My Audi A3 won't start and I suspect it's a dead battery. What steps can I take to troubleshoot and fix this issue?
ReplyFirst, check if your battery terminals are corroded. If they are, clean them with a mixture of baking soda and water. Next, try jump starting your car with another vehicle. If it still won't start, it's likely a faulty battery and you should have it replaced.
Before attempting to jump start your Audi A3, make sure to check the owner's manual for specific instructions. Also, consider investing in a portable jump starter for emergencies.
